What is Snowflake Time Travel and Data Recovery?

Snowflake Time Travel is a feature that allows you to access historical data at any point within a specified retention period. This is particularly useful for recovering data accidentally deleted or altered. Drawbacks / Risks

  1. Cost: Increased storage costs due to extended retention periods.
  2. Complexity: May require initial setup and configuration knowledge.
  3. Performance Impact: Large datasets may slow down query performance.

Common Mistakes & How to Avoid

  1. Ignoring Retention Settings: Always configure the retention period based on business needs.
  2. Overlooking Costs: Monitor storage usage to avoid unnecessary expenses.
  3. Neglecting Backups: Use time travel alongside traditional backups for extra security.
  4. Misconfiguring Access: Ensure proper access controls to avoid unauthorized changes.
